Age | Commit message (Collapse) | Author | |
---|---|---|---|
2012-08-21 | code cleanup: vfont's used confusing and over complicated method of storing ↵ | Campbell Barton | |
memory for loaded fonts, not store as a temp var in the fonts. | |||
2012-08-20 | Cycles / Cmake: | Thomas Dinges | |
* Removed last instance of "BLENDER_PLUGIN" define, removed in r39465 in the cycles branch. | |||
2012-08-18 | cmake option to build without iksolver | Campbell Barton | |
2012-08-18 | style cleanup: also correct some doxy comments | Campbell Barton | |
2012-08-12 | style cleanup | Campbell Barton | |
2012-08-12 | code cleanup: WM naming conventions | Campbell Barton | |
2012-08-11 | add MEM_recallocN(), so bytes are ensured to be zero'd when growing. | Campbell Barton | |
2012-08-10 | Fix for particle object rendering in Cycles. On object sync the object first ↵ | Lukas Toenne | |
has to determine if a particle update is needed (which depends on dupli objects and their meshes), before deciding to skip the actual syncing. | |||
2012-08-10 | Smoke: High res on even resolution did not write to all cells (downsampling ↵ | Daniel Genrich | |
= n-1, upsampling = n). Thanks goes to MiikaH. | |||
2012-08-10 | Cycles Test App: | Thomas Dinges | |
* Fix for changes in the OpenImageIO API. | |||
2012-08-08 | code cleanup: rename G.afbreek --> is_break, G.rendering --> is_rendering | Campbell Barton | |
2012-08-08 | patch [#32282] Fix segfault on exit in IM shutdown. | Campbell Barton | |
from Bill Currie (taniwha) | |||
2012-08-07 | Fix for fix, now nested | Jens Verwiebe | |
2012-08-07 | Fix for endiantest, xcode condition interferred with other os | Jens Verwiebe | |
2012-08-07 | OSX: disable kernels in cycles gpu again, would only work in 10.8 afaik | Jens Verwiebe | |
2012-08-07 | OSX/cmake: Mountain-Lion (10.8 )adaptions, skip unsupported endianess etc., ↵ | Jens Verwiebe | |
todo: deployment target management | |||
2012-08-06 | style cleanup | Campbell Barton | |
2012-08-04 | Code cleanup: | Thomas Dinges | |
* Remove BSP_GhostTest, not used and working for ages, approved by Sergey. | |||
2012-08-02 | Remove old boolean operation module | Sergey Sharybin | |
Carve proved it's a way to go, so the time have came to get rid of old boolean operation module which isn't used anymore. Still kept BOP interface but move it to BSP module. At some point it could be cleaned up further (like perhaps removed extra abstraction level or so) but would be nice to combine such a refactor with making BSP aware of NGons. Tested on linux using both cmake and scons, possible regressions on windows/osx. Would check windoes build just after commit. | |||
2012-08-02 | Bugfix: High resolution "exploded" when using uneven resolutions, sometimes ↵ | Daniel Genrich | |
with specific object scaling. Part of Smoke Development Phase III. Credit also goes to MiikaH: It was a teamwork effort and took days to track down. :) | |||
2012-08-01 | Cycles: | Thomas Dinges | |
* Removed outdated OpenCL comments, kernel features are defined in kernel_types.h now. | |||
2012-08-01 | fix crash when polling image sample outside image space. | Campbell Barton | |
also remove historic comment which isnt helpful. | |||
2012-08-01 | Fix #32205: Holdout shader + transparent background stays black with Alpha = 1 | Sergey Sharybin | |
It was read of initialized memory around holdout_weight in cases when holdout material is used. Seems that it should be assigned to result of shader_holdout_eval here. If Brecht could double check this it'll be great. This could potentially fix #32224: Holdout Error with CUDA Cycles Render | |||
2012-08-01 | style cleanup: whitespace, also add '?' to save over popup since it wasnt ↵ | Campbell Barton | |
totally clear it was a question (user pointed this out, they thought it was just notification and lost their work). | |||
2012-08-01 | quiet spacenav output on linux for regular builds, ifdef signed int for msvc ↵ | Campbell Barton | |
openmp. | |||
2012-07-31 | Remove "Loading byte/float" debug messages. They were added at the time | Sergey Sharybin | |
we've been looking into texture limit for Mango and it's not needed now. Anyway, this prints didn't cover all the cases when images were loading. | |||
2012-07-31 | Fix cycles issue with wrong texture coordinates on a second render layer with | Brecht Van Lommel | |
a mask layer enabled. | |||
2012-07-31 | Code tweak removing comment, the fix here is indeed correct. | Brecht Van Lommel | |
2012-07-31 | Fix warnings on old apple GCC compiler due to no support for alloc_size ↵ | Brecht Van Lommel | |
attribute. | |||
2012-07-29 | Additional fix #32074, by Sven-Hendrik Haase (svenstaro). Boost version ↵ | Lukas Toenne | |
header must be included in cycles in order to expand the version check macro. | |||
2012-07-28 | Blender now compiles with recent clang | Sergey Sharybin | |
2012-07-28 | defines to make it easier to manage ik stretch constants (these may need to ↵ | Campbell Barton | |
be tweaked to fix [#32174]) | |||
2012-07-28 | style cleanup | Campbell Barton | |
2012-07-28 | IK's were converting double -> float -> double's in a few places, since ↵ | Campbell Barton | |
precision is important and doubles are used a lot here anyway. just use doubles, also quiet some double promotion warnings. | |||
2012-07-27 | Fix compile errors on VC++ 2012 RC1. | Daniel Genrich | |
Note: Compile still fails during ceres compile (namespace tr1 problems). | |||
2012-07-26 | fix some types and incorrect info | Campbell Barton | |
2012-07-26 | Added a particle index output to the Particle Info Cycles node. This is ↵ | Lukas Toenne | |
required to get consistent ID numbers for particles. The Object ID is not usable since it's a user defined value of the instanced object, which does not vary per instance. Also the random value from the object info node is not consistent over time, since it only depends on the index in the dupli list (so each emitted or dying particle shifts the value). The particle index is always the same for a specific particle. Randomized values can be generated from this with the use of a noise texture. | |||
2012-07-26 | Make Cycles compatible with older boost versions. | Sergey Sharybin | |
Patch by IRIE Shinsuke, thanks! | |||
2012-07-24 | Debug option for guarded allocation: store name of original datablock | Sergey Sharybin | |
when using MEM_dupallocN. This helps figuring out issues with non-freed dup_alloc blocks, Simply enable DEBUG_MEMDUPLINAME in mallocn.c file. | |||
2012-07-24 | add prints for texture loading (we're running into texture limit a lot so ↵ | Campbell Barton | |
its handy to see whats actually loading from the blend files) | |||
2012-07-23 | fix for cycles bug in localview: see r48269, bits used for localview gave ↵ | Campbell Barton | |
collisions with PathRayFlag's | |||
2012-07-22 | code cleanup: replace cos(M_PI / 4) and sin(M_PI / 4) with M_SQRT1_2 define | Campbell Barton | |
also some minor style cleanup. | |||
2012-07-22 | Removed nested comment, which causes compiler errors. | Lukas Toenne | |
2012-07-22 | style cleanup | Campbell Barton | |
2012-07-21 | Boolean modifier: prevent crashes when carve returns bad topology | Sergey Sharybin | |
For sure actual issue is in carve's triangulation system which need to be investigated and fixed. For now only fixed by re-shuffling a bit existing degenerative faces check and added extra checks there. Would look into actual fix a bit later. | |||
2012-07-19 | print names of nodes/sockets when cycles complains about only being able to ↵ | Campbell Barton | |
connect a closure to another closure. | |||
2012-07-17 | code cleanup: spelling | Campbell Barton | |
2012-07-14 | header comment cleanup, explain whats the difference between confusingly ↵ | Campbell Barton | |
named drarnode.c and node_draw.c. | |||
2012-07-14 | use gcc attributes for BLI alloc functions | Campbell Barton | |
2012-07-12 | OSX: make the progressbar in dock a gradient, to give it a more matching 3D ↵ | Jens Verwiebe | |
appearance |